Manual of mathematics, evidently for the use of a military officer, compiled by James Douglas.
Item
Identifier: MS.3939
Scope and Contents
The manual, compiled in 1698 (dates on pages 334a, 401), contains arithmetic, based on E Cocker's ‘Arithmetick’, with some rules for extracting roots by algebra and logarithms; "the doctrine of decimall fractions takne out of Mr. Coker's Decimall Arithmetick", (page 156); and 'the doctrine of plain triangles, or ... plain trigonometry' (page 334a), with rules for ascertaining heights, etc., with instruments.The words 'Heir endeth so much of the arithmetick as a souldier ought...

Manuscript containing directions for various dances.
File
Identifier: MS.3860
Scope and Contents
The contents are as follows: directions for dancing quadrilles, waltzes, reels, and country dances: 'Contre-danses à Paris, 1818' (folio 1); 'Country Dances' (folio 49); 'A selection of reel steps or steps for setting, 1818'. The paper is watermarked 1820 and later. Additions dated 1849 occur on folios 10, 36-37.
